Transaction ac8cf566749e64d13dd9c4a121eda44189784c0447ed15287f3c9360552b6c5a
1 Input
1 Output
-
ac8cf566749e64d13dd9c4a121eda44189784c0447ed15287f3c9360552b6c5a:0
- value
- 33834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ab19e155d950b5995e025f47a1d240f0765c4305 OP_EQUAL
- address
- 3HHiUY2MTBE4Co2PoySTAJ5fqmia53Ar8Q